[QUOTE="Schnapper, post: 607803, member: 103866"] Hello, I’ve recently finished the building of my HTPC and am very happy with it. I have however had an issue with MediaPortal to which I can not find a solution. Background; Blurays are ripped and stored as mkv on desktop computer running W7. Have created a Homegroup and shared the MKV folder with the movies. HTPC has been directly connected to router for testing (and still is until I get a fix). All the drivers are up to date. Issue; I’ve loaded MP and set up StreamedMP and all the codecs. My issue is that when I go into Moving Pictures and select the movie I want to load the program freezes. It does not close but it goes non-responsive. With task manager open I can see that the network usage jumps to 85% and sits there for 8-10mins (this number varies) and then MP begins to respond and the movie starts. I am sure this is a MP issue as when I load an mkv file through WMC or VLC I do not have a problem. Hardware is as below. I have searched for answers but not yet sure what the problem actually is so the search is broad at the moment. If anyone can point me in a troubleshoot direction that would be appreciated. Because this doesn't crash I have nothing from Watchdog.
